Morgan Selected for Second Term on Seventh Circuit Bar Association’s Board of Governors

Taft attorney Donnie Morgan has been selected for another term on the Seventh Circuit Bar Association’s Board of Governors. The board of governors manages and governs the association, which plans marquee educational and social events throughout the circuit and works with lawyers and judges to improve the administration of justice in the circuit.

Morgan is a member of Taft’s appellate practice and public law team. He has extensive experience advising elected officials and practicing at all levels of the federal and Indiana judicial systems, including work on appeals before the U.S. Supreme Court and the Indiana Supreme Court. He serves on the board of governors for the Seventh Circuit Bar Association, the Indianapolis Bar Association’s board of directors, and the Section 1983 subcommittee of the Seventh Circuit’s Committee on Pattern Civil Jury Instructions.
